我是Commerce Server开发的新手,我几天就遇到了一个问题而无法在网上找到任何问题。
背景:我们已经在Commerce Server 2009中使用了目录设置版本,我们还使用Commerce Server API从SharePoint应用程序中检索,修改目录。
问题:我面临的问题是,我不知道如何检索'类别'与产品相关。一个产品可以包含1到多个与之关联的类别。我有产品ID,我想要检索所有'类别'与产品相关联,或者可以是产品的所有类别相关信息。我查找了API,并且有一些方法,例如' GetCategory',' GetProduct'但是通过这些方法检索的信息对我没用。
问题:有没有办法检索与产品相关的类别?是什么原因导致这种方法不在Commerce Server API中?
提前感谢!
答案 0 :(得分:1)
通过调用Product获取GetProduct对象,然后访问属性ParentCategoryNames以获取产品父类别的只读集合。此外,还有其他几个Product
属性可提供不同的类别信息(例如PrimaryParentCategoryName)。